The Comprehensive Guide to Composite Door Restoration
Composite doors have become a popular option for property owners due to their toughness and visual appeal. Made from a combination of products such as wood, PVC, and insulating foam, they provide exceptional advantages over conventional wood exterior doors. Nevertheless, in time and with exposure to the components, even the most robust composite doors may show indications of wear and tear. This guide intends to light up the procedure of composite door restoration, allowing house owners to breathe brand-new life into their entryways.
Understanding Composite Doors
Before diving into restoration methods, it is necessary to comprehend what composite doors are made of and why they are preferred.
Composition of Composite Doors:Core Materials: A combination of strong timber and an insulating foam core provides strength and energy effectiveness.External Layer: Typically constructed of a resilient, weather-resistant skin made from products like PVC, fiberglass, or wood.Support: Steel and aluminum reinforcements can be included to enhance security and durability.Advantages of Composite Doors:Durability: Resistant to warping, cracking, or swelling, they can endure extreme climate condition.Energy Efficiency: Composite doors frequently bear an energy score, guaranteeing they help in reducing heating expenses.Low Maintenance: Unlike standard wood doors, composite doors require minimal maintenance.Versatile Design: Available in various styles, colors, and ends up to fit varied tastes.Signs Your Composite Door Needs Restoration
Property owners should regularly check their composite doors for typical signs of wear. Restoration might be needed if one or more of the following indications exist:
Fading and Discoloration: Exposure to sunshine can result in a loss of color and vibrancy.Scratches and Scuffs: Everyday wear and tear, along with unintentional bumps, can mar the surface.Damages: Heavy objects can result in dents that impact both the door's visual appeals and functionality.Sealing Issues: Signs of drafts or water leaks may suggest that the seals and hinges require attention.The Composite Door Restoration Process
Bring back a composite door might appear a challenging job, but with the right tools and approach, it can be a workable and satisfying endeavor.
Step-by-Step Restoration Guide:
Gather Tools and Materials:
Soft cloths and spongesDetergent or moderate cleanerSandpaper (fine-grade)Paint or wood stain (if required)Sealant or weather condition strippingScrewdriverTouch-up paint (for scratches and scuffs)
Cleaning the Door:
Begin by completely cleaning the door with a mix of detergent and warm water to eliminate dirt and grime.Use a soft fabric or sponge to carefully scrub the surface area. Rinse with clean water and let it dry totally.
Assessing Damage:
Inspect the door for deep scratches, dents, or a damaged finish.For deep scratches, consider using touch-up paint or wood filler to level the surface area.
Sanding and Smoothing:
If the door surface area is rough or if paint has begun to peel, utilize fine-grade sandpaper to ravel the location.Prevent over-sanding, as this can damage the door's outer layer.
Applying Paint or Stain:
For discolored doors, use a fresh coat of paint or wood stain that matches the original finish.Use even strokes and let the very first coat dry before using a second coat if required.
Sealing the Edges:
Inspect the weather condition removing and seals around the door. If they are damaged, get rid of the old material and change it with brand-new weather condition stripping or sealant to guarantee the door remains energy effective and secure.
Last Inspection:
